System Technical Secures Contract for the Patriot Missile Air-Defense System
September 20, 2019 | Business WireEstimated reading time: Less than a minute
System technical announced that it has been awarded a US Army Tank and Automotive Command (TACOM) contract supporting maintenance requirements for the Patriot Missile Air-Defense System. The Patriot counters tactical ballistic missiles and advanced aircraft. Developed by Raytheon, the Patriot system was used in combat for the first time in 1991 during the Gulf War. The Patriot currently supports ongoing military operations in over 15 countries worldwide. Work for the contract will be performed at the Company’s headquarters in Torrance, California.
